#729DA7 Hex color

#729DA7

The hexadecimal color code #729DA7 corresponds to the code RGB( 114, 157, 167 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,45 level), green (at 0,62 level) and blue (at 0,65 level). Its brightness is 55% and its saturation is 23%. It is composed of red at 26%, green at 35% and blue at 38%.
